Output 668379c189c2828002b3c4088b7ce176cefe19e52e700482d871974afb42ab99:0

value
15516711
script pubkey
OP_0 OP_PUSHBYTES_20 3f7ba1b0e2b6adf6abbd27adf120496d86e7bce8
address
bc1q8aa6rv8zk6kld2aay7klzgzfdkrw008gqtn3c7
transaction
668379c189c2828002b3c4088b7ce176cefe19e52e700482d871974afb42ab99
spent
true